About the Performance

Paige in Full is a visual mixtape that blends poetry, dance, visual arts, and music to tell the tale of a multicultural girl growing up in Baltimore, Maryland. The production explores how a young woman’s identity is shaped by her ethnicity and popular culture, telling a personal yet universal story through the lens of hip-hop. 

The creative team behind Paige in Full is sibling-duo Paige Hernandez (writer and performer), Nick tha 1da (musician), Danielle A. Drakes (director), and Bryan Joseph Lee (dramaturg). The play was produced by B-FLY Entertainment. 

Genevieve Williams of Discovery Theatre said the following about the show, “Paige is pure hip hop. She breathes it. It’s a part of her DNA. She can connect the songs and the culture to her entire being. More importantly, she can explain it to the rest of us. She is beautifully articulate in her storytelling… she is enticing in her mastery of her body and movement. This performance is a delight.”

Paige Hernandez is a critically acclaimed performer, director, choreographer, and playwright. She has performed on many stages throughout the US, including Arena Stage, Roundhouse, Everyman Theatre, The Kennedy Center, Imagination Stage, Fulton Theatre, Ohio Theatre, Manship Theatre, and others. She has been commissioned by several companies, including the National New Play Network, the Smithsonian, The Kennedy Center, La Jolla Playhouse, and the Glimmerglass Festival. As a critically acclaimed b-girl, Paige’s choreography has been seen nationwide, including The Kennedy Center’s Knuffle Bunny and American Scrapbook. She has been the recipient of an Individual Artist Award from the Maryland State Arts Council, four Helen Hayes nominations, and was recently named one of the Top 5 Most Produced Artists for Theatre for Young Audiences. Paige is a graduate of the Baltimore School for the Arts and the University of Maryland, College Park.

ABOUT THE NJPAC ON THE MIC PODCAST

NJPAC On the Mic invites your students to expand their experience of attending a SchoolTime Performances show. We provide three podcast episodes for each production, suitably aligned with New Jersey Student Learning Standards (NJSLS) and New Jersey Social and Emotional Learning (SEL) Competencies. With NJPAC on the Mic, the learning begins before—and continues beyond—your visit to the New Jersey Performing Arts Center!
